Pangkalan Kerinci, Jun 12, 2020 – Asia Pacific Yarn (APY) is proud to announce that our sustainable viscose yarn has been awarded the OEKO-TEX® STD 100 certification by TESTEX AG. Conformance to Annex 6 product class I, confirms that our Yarn is free from any harmful substances and safe to use in baby articles, while additionally fulfilling the requirements of Annex XVII of REACH, US CPSIA and Chinese standard GB 18401:2010.

Compliance to the OEKO-TEX® STD 100 is achieved through rigorous testing by an independent laboratory. This certification is an important step for APY to demonstrating that our products meet the prescribed human health and ecological requirements.

About Asia Pacific Rayon:
Asia Pacific Rayon (APR), the first integrated viscose-rayon manufacturer in Asia, commenced operations earlier this year and has a production capacity of 240,000 tonnes a year. Located in Pangkalan Kerinci, Riau province, APR’s wood fibre comes from sustainably-managed plantations that are traceable along the entire value chain from nursery to viscose-rayon.
